We are looking for an enthusiastic and innovative Carpentry & Joinery Lecturer to help shape the future of the next generation of skilled professionals at Stephenson College.
You will be required to plan, prepare and deliver high quality and challenging learning experiences across a range of topics within Construction including theory and practical, to help students develop practical skills and achieve their qualifications.
You will have a passion for innovation, bringing new ideas and embedding new technologies into the learning environment to meet the needs of diverse learners and provide constructive feedback and guidance to help them achieve their goals.
A relevant qualification or significant practical experience are required and teaching and/or mentoring experience is desirable. However, we are happy to consider candidates from industry with significant practical experience who are looking to get into education and will support you to obtain a teaching qualification.
Loughborough College Group is formed of Brooksby College, Loughborough College, Stephenson College and IGNITE Performing Arts. We have a vast curriculum across campus’s offering challenging and engaging learning experiences for our students.
